What role did the Catholic Church play in governing Spain’s American empire?

Spain was a very Catholic state and Phillip II thought of himself a champion of Catholicism, so the Catholic Church played a major role in Spain's American empire. Church officials were royal advisors and the church also sent missionaries to convert natives to Catholicism and help regulate the activities of the settlers.
